With the increasing number of vehicles worldwide and the increasing demand for parking spaces, effective management methods are in urgent need to improve the utilization efficiency of parking spaces. In spite of many previous studies focusing on how to detect the status of parking spaces and guide vehicles, the schemes proposed by these studies can only provide certain parking information rather than effectively manage parking spaces. In this paper, a system based on intelligent parking lock is designed to realize functions of query, reservation and management, based on which, drivers can reserve the free parking space in advance. This system can ensure that the reserved parking space is not misoccupied, which can also automatically close the parking lock and perform functions such as billing after the vehicle leaves.
